About Disney Cruise Line

Since launching in 1998, Disney Cruise Line has established itself as a leader in the cruise industry, providing a setting where families can reconnect, adults can recharge and children can experience all Disney has to offer. Today, the award-winning Disney Cruise Line continues to expand its blueprint for family cruising with a fleet of six ships — the Disney Magic, Disney Wonder, Disney Dream, Disney Fantasy, Disney Wish, and Disney Treasure — and seven more ships on the way, including the expanded relationship with Oriental Land Company Ltd. to bring Disney cruise vacations to Japan, by 2031. The Disney Cruise Line fleet sails to destinations in The Bahamas, the Caribbean, Europe, Alaska, Mexico, Canada, Hawaii, the South Pacific, and Australia and New Zealand. The Disney Adventure, setting sail in 2025, will be the first to home port in Singapore.

About the Role

Disney Cruise Line (DCL) is seeking a dynamic and passionate Regional Recruiter based in Singapore. This role is pivotal in identifying, engaging, and hiring exceptional talent for the shipboard crew across the region.  The ideal candidate will bring creativity, strong cultural insight, and a deep commitment to excellence in sourcing candidates who embody the Disney brand and values. 

The Regional Recruiter will partner closely with a highly collaborative team of recruiters based in Celebration, Florida, London, England, and The Bahamas.  This unique role will help shape the future of our crew experience, support high-volume hiring needs, and contribute to the success of the most ambitious growth in DCL history. 

As a regional subject matter expert in talent acquisition, this role will be responsible for developing and executing innovative recruitment strategies that resonate with regional talent markets, strengthening collaboration with the global DCL Talent Connection team, and providing guidance on regional best practices to support consistent, high-quality hiring outcomes.    

Responsibilities:

  • Lead end-to-end, full-cycle recruitment for shipboard roles, including sourcing, screening, interviewing, and selecting crew for onboard positions
  • Provide comprehensive recruitment support across multiple business areas, including Hotel, HR, Entertainment, and Marine & Technical Operations.
  • Build, nurture, and maintain strong long-term relationships with local recruitment partners, manning agencies, hospitality schools, and training institutions throughout the region. 
  • Collaborate closely with the global DCL Talent Connection team to align regional hiring strategies, timelines, workforce planning, and candidate pipelines.
  • Plan, lead, and execute regional recruitment campaigns and outreach strategies tailored to local labor markets, cultural nuances, and candidate expectations.  
  • Conduct interviews for high-volume applicant populations both virtually and in person, ensuring consistent, inclusive and engaging candidate experience. 
  • Serve as a key DCL brand ambassador by representing Disney Cruise Line at regional job fairs, career fairs, industry events, and university recruitment across Southeast Asia.
  • Partner with regional stakeholders to design and deliver hiring events and recruitment activations that drive strong candidate engagement and awareness of shipboard career opportunities. 
  • Utilize recruitment systems and tools to manage candidate data, including tracking pipelines, monitoring hiring progress, and delivering regional support and insights. 
  • Ability to work independently while building and sustaining strong relationships in a remote, cross-regional environment.
  • Travel extensively within Southeast Asia and internationally, as needed, to support relationship-building, hiring events, and recruitment initiatives. 
  • Continuously develop business knowledge of the maritime and hospitality industries and share regional market insights and best practices with the broader DCL Talent Connection team.    

Qualifications:

  • Minimum 3 – 5 years of experience leading high-volume or complex recruitment efforts, preferably within the hospitality, cruise, maritime or international staffing environment.
  • Strong understanding of the Southeast Asian labor markets, talent pipelines, and cultural nuances impacting recruitment and hiring practices.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build credibility, trust, and influence across culturally diverse teams and stakeholders.
  • Proven ability to manage multiple, competing priorities in a fast-paced, global environment while maintaining attention to detail and quality.

Preferred Attributes:

  • Hands on experience using recruitment platforms, applicant tracking systems, and hiring technology to manage pipelines and reporting.   
  • Strong passion for Disney’s storytelling, brand standards, and guest-centric culture.
  • Fluency in English and one or more Southeast Asia languages is strongly preferred.
  • Experience working with cross-functional and internationally dispersed teams.
  • Prior exposure to maritime recruitment, cruise industry operations, or shipboard staffing models is a plus.
